Himiko

Himiko
Рейтинг
560
Регистрация
28.08.2008
Должность
ООО "Системные интеграции", Генеральный директор. ООО "Медиа-группа "Автор", Исполнительный директор
15.04.1985
Fi9hter:
Ну для таких там написано что это только для ознакомления с тем что такое ВДС. Апач с панелью isp уже 64 метра жрет, какие там еще сайты.
На WP у меня вообще 192 метра не хватает даже, выходит за лимит.

Тем не менее умудряются, т.к. можно за лимит выйти.

Да и настроить можно, чтобы меньше памяти "кушал".

Здравствуйте. Это тема для отзывов, поэтому лучше свяжитесь со мной в ICQ 392-395 или по e-mail: me@himik.org.ru

Pilat:
Ну разумеется это количество одновременных подключений, и по совместительству количество параллельно выполняющихся процессов. А это количество очень хорошо зависит от количества процессоров. Сделаете 100 подключений - получится 100 запросов в секунду, сделаете 10 - получите 100 запросов в секунду. Только память зря транжирить.

Согласен, память не резиновая. с 512, как у ТС, смысла никакого.

Pilat:
10 - это достаточно и никаких проблем это вызвать нее должно. 50-100 - это нонсенс и абсурд. У Вас что, 100 процессоров в системе?

MaxClients когда-то указывалось в зависимости от количества процессоров?😮

Это количество одновременных подключаний, которые обрабатывает apache. У меня, к примеру, их не меньше 5-15 одновременно. (процессов столько тоже нет) Да, 50-100 - это достаточно много.

Pilat:
Proxoma, MaxClients поставьте в 10, а не 500. Перед апачем поставьте nginx. Это сразу выправит положение с памятью.

Господа, пишите понятней. Даже я не понял, что советуют все предыдущие советчики - слишком много букв.

Скажем 10 это мало, часто проблемы из-за этого на посещаемых ресурсах. Ставьте от 30 до 50-100. Больше не вижу смысла.

DLag:
Можно засунуть еще больше клиентов на ноды. 😂

Да. Клиенты бы радовались, что их сайты умудряются работать на VDS с 64Mb памяти и за 149 рублей. (там freebsd + можно "вылезать" за лимит 64Mb периодически).

Потом съезжают с firstvds и в шоке, что на таких ресурсах вообще ничего не запускается.:)

Ко мне уже обращались с оптимизацией линукса с 128Mb памяти. И в шоке, что для линукса это только "впритык". И начинается: "ну я же сидел на 64mb, тут взял больше и почему-то не работает".

Так что, если всё будет работать стабильно, "кушать" меньше памяти, да и на новой операционке, то это хорошая новость :)

Я показал как надо, мало-ли, скажи конкретно что то не верно дал или ошибка ?

Или вы умничаете от делать нечего хе-х ну блин туго всё идёт

Просто безсмысленный совет обсолютно. Ничего вообще это не изменит то, что вы дали. Вот и всё.

P.S.:Это тоже самое, что я писал про ваш русский язык) Разговаривать всё-равно по-другому не начнёте, да и на знания это не влияет.Так же и apache будет работать точно так же, просто корректно будет прописано:)

@ntonio:
скачал, дальше это куда вставить нужно в фаил my.cnf ???

Сначала запустите. Потом всё, что он скажет в my.cnf и перезагрузите mysql

madoff:
Да возможно что он не указал работу, префорка, я ему указал строку <IfModule prefork.c>, вот отличие, мало ли как апачи воспринимает то что он написал я дал правильно как надо писать.

1. Он просто дал пример настроек.

2. Если вы не в курсе, ifModule только проверяет, работает ли данный модуль и если работает, то использует эти директивы. Если не указать, то будет использовать в не зависимости от того, prefork он или нет.

Поэтому не вижу смысла в данной корректировке.

madoff:
Какой же вы админ если вы не понимаете этого ?

Как я и говорил, у вас проблемы с русским языком, вас сложно понять в принципе.

Да и амбиций много, в сообщениях можно процентов 60 выкидывать, а остольное долго переваривать.

Не каждому это под силу:)


StartServers 5
MinSpareServers 5
MaxSpareServers 10
ServerLimit 512
MaxClients 512
MaxRequestsPerChild 64

Попробуйте сделать так

<IfModule prefork.c>
StartServers 5
MinSpareServers 5
MaxSpareServers 10
ServerLimit 512
MaxClients 512
MaxRequestsPerChild 64
</IfModule>

Называется, найди 10 отличий :) Смысл не объясните?

Всего: 9394